Icarus, directed and choreographed by Walid Aouni (who also designed scenography for the show), was staged by the Egyptian Modern Dance Theatre Company at the Cairo Opera House on 3 and 4 April.

The performance paralled the celebrations for the Modern Dance Theatre Company’s silver jubilee. Within this context, Walid Aouni, the founder and first choreographer and director of the troupe, has been honored for his years-long contribution to Egypt's artistic scene.

Throughout his career, Aouni has directed more than 25 shows for the Egyptian Modern Dance Theatre Company, as well as many ceremonies for the ministry of culture and the ministry of defence.

He has also contributed to various other national celebrations in Egypt.

Icarus was the troupe's first performance staged when the Modern Dance Theatre Company was launched back in 1993.
